JOB DESCRIPTION

 

Main Purpose

Reporting to the Team Leader, who is also the SG Health and Safety Coordinator, the Safeguards Safety Specialist provides support in the preparation, coordination and implementation of departmental initiatives related to SG specific operational health and safety, including radiation safety, and provides professional advice and services on occupational health and safety to the Department.

Role

The Safeguards Safety Specialist is: (1) a subject matter expert supporting and monitoring operational radiation safety and industrial health and safety for SG activities (2) a team member, assisting the SG Health and Safety Coordinator and other members of the SG Health and Safety Sub-committee (SG SHS) in the development and update of safety guidance and tools supporting the implementation of departmental processes related to radiation safety and occupational health and safety (3) a facilitator, supporting SG Radiation Protection Officers by providing them relevant guidance and training.

Advertisement

Functions / Key Results Expected

Participate and support the SG Health and Safety Coordinator in preparing the SG SHS meetings and activities.
Contribute to the preparation of operational guidance, provide expert support and advice on Occupational H&S and radiation safety matters and develop and implement expert level training on these subjects for SG staff.
Record, follow up, investigate and report H&S incidents/accidents and near miss, monitor the status of actions planned as a result of those investigations, collect lessons learned and disseminate them across the SG Department.
